USACA Eastern Conference Under-15 Tournament
USACA South East Region (SER) announced its 14-man squad to participate in USACA Eastern Conference U15 Tournament to be held at Cedar Fork District Park – 228 Aviation Pkwy, Morrisville, North Carolina from May 24 to 26, 2014. The other participating teams will be from USACA’s other 3 Regions that make up USACA Eastern Conference – North East Region (NER), New York Region (NYR) and Atlantic Region (AR). The top 2 finishers from this tournament will qualify for USACA National U15 Championships to
be held in Northern California from June 26 to 29.

Preparation for US National Youth Tournaments

Promoting the World’s Best Game!
New York Region’s preparation for the two national tournaments gets into full gear next weekend in preparation for the USACA Eastern Conference Under-15 tournament scheduled for Raleigh, North Carolina on May 24-26. The national finals will be held in Santa Clara, California on June 26-29. The Under 17 tournament will be held from August 11-17 at a venue to be determined.
The first session will be held at Gateway on Saturday and Sunday, April 26 and 27 from 10:30 am to 2:00 pm. Other sessions will be held on May 3, 10 and 17. All sessions are mandatory and all youngsters within the two age groups who are interested in representing the region are invited to attend.
The eligibility rules mandates that the U-15 group, must be born after September 1, 1998 and the Under-17 group, after September 1, 1996. Parents are expected to attend.

New York Cricket Academy, Youth Series
Two matches were contested at Baisley Cage Cricket Park with Zahib Tariq’s XI versus Trevis Ross’ XI. Batting first Tariq’s troops were lead by openers Mohib Tariq 63 and Hamza Rana 41 who laid a plateau of a foundation. Jason Hall scored 25 as Tariq’s XI posted 164/5 (20). Bowling for Ross, Leon Mohabir had 2/27 with a wicket each for Trevis Ross, Ryan Persaud and Brandon Dat.
Ross’ XI made a game of the chase with Ryan Ramnarine 40, and Skipper Ross 34. It was Nicholas Harripersaud who stole the show for Tariq’s XI with 5/16 to lead his side to a 14 run win.
Randall Wilson’s XI clashed with Sajib Salam’s XI in the second encounter with Wilson’s XI taking first strike. Usman Ashraf continued to build a reputation for himself with 51. Support came from captain Wilson 36 and Derick Narine 26 as Wilson’s XI closed on 165/5. Hamza Babar took 2/27 bowling for Salam’s XI.
Salam’s XI like Ross’ XI batting second were intent on making use of a good day out on the park as Naiem Hasan 31, Aown Iqbal 22 and Salam 22 made a game of the chase. Usman Ashraf had other ideas as he claimed three (3) wickets to add to his half century to keep Salam’s unit at bay. Derick Narine provided ample support with two (2) wickets as Salam’s XI could only manage 149 losing by 16 runs.

Metro League To Bowl Off With Innovative Sixes Tourney
by Dyon Ravello,
The New York Metropolitan Districts Cricket Association (MCL) bowls off on May 11th 2014, Mother’s Day. All 14 teams will participate in the MCL Sixes at Gateway Park, (Exit 15 off the Belt Parkway, at Gateway Mall). The knockout tourney will see seven teams advance to the quarterfinals after the preliminary round. The teams will draw for numbers on the day, to determine each fixture.
The Clement “Busta” Lawrence Premier League commences a week later on May 18th 2014. The MCL 40 over championship is the marquee competition in the league as the MCL will return to divisional format in 2015. The top eight (8) teams at the end of the 2014 season will contest Division One in 2015, with the lower six (6) plus additional teams to challenge for promotion in the Second Division. The top four teams will advance to the semifinals for a shot at a place in the August 17th final.
The Roy Sweeney Twenty/20 Challenge Cup will be staged from August 24th. Teams have been divided into two groups:
Group A: Villagers, Cosmos, Mid Island, Staten Island, Pioneer, Lucas, and Lions.
Group B: Westbury, Progressive, New Hope, Spice Island, Suburbia, River Valley, and Sheffield
Like the Busta Lawrence Premier League, the Sweeney Twenty/20 Challenge moves to semifinals with the top two teams from each group to vie in semifinals and finals on October 5th 2014.
MCL rounds out the 2014 season on October 12th 2014 with the Leroy Bedassee Super 3 another innovative one-day challenge. The best three teams from the Busta Lawrence Premier League will face off with each team batting just once and bowling only once as well. Teams will not bowl to the team they batted against with the average run rates determining the Champions.
